Passengers Bristle at Low-Cost Airlines' Hidden Fees
On his way to an aviation law congress in Sicily to discuss low-cost carriers, Dan Miró left his home in Barcelona in a rush and forgot the Ryanair boarding pass that he had printed out at home. “When I arrived at the airport, the company told me that I had to pay €40 so that Ryanair would print this piece of paper or else I couldn’t fly,” he said in an interview with the International Herald Tribune. “I realized what they were doing was illegal, and, as a lawyer, I felt it my obligation to do… (www.nytimes.com) More...Sort type: [Top] [Newest]
